Multi-mode Flock Safety security assessment tool.
---
## Capabilities
### CVE Scanning (v1)
| CVE | Score | Description |
|-----|-------|-------------|
| **CVE-2025-59403** | 9.8 | Unauthenticated admin API / ADB RCE |
| **CVE-2025-59407** | CRIT | Hardcoded keystore crypto key |
| **CVE-2025-47818** | HIGH | Hardcoded fallback hotspot credentials |
| **CVE-2025-47823** | HIGH | Hardcoded system password on ALPR firmware |
### Flock Instance Discovery (v2 — NEW)
Scans any subnet for all known Flock camera fingerprints.
| Fingerprint | Port | Detection |
|-------------|------|-----------|
| **ADB shell** | 5555 | `getprop ro.product.model` → Flock/Falcon/Sparrow |
| **Admin web UI** | 80/443 | GainSec's `admin_page_template.html` in HTTP body |
| **ONVIF device** | 80/443/8899 | SOAP `GetDeviceInformation` → manufacturer string |
| **SpeedPourer** | 21 | FTP banner / admin page references |
| **FRP tunnel** | 7000-7500 | Fast Reverse Proxy banner grab |
| **Cloud DNS** | — | Admin UI contains `*.flocksafety.com` URLs |
| **All 4 CVEs** | — | Per-host exploit checks run automatically |
### Traffic Analysis (v2 — NEW)
Determines if a Flock camera sends data to **the cloud** or a **local station**.
```
CLOUD → Sends data to api.flocksafety.com / Flock infrastructure
LOCAL_STATION → Data stays on-prem (no cloud contact detected)
INDETERMINATE → Unable to determine (camera may be offline)
```
Detection methods:
- **DNS resolution** of `api.flocksafety.com` and other Flock domains
- **Admin UI inspection** — `/metadata`, `/config` endpoints checked for cloud URLs vs internal IPs
- **FRP tunnel detection** — Reverse Proxy tunnel on ports 7000/7500
- **ADB network config** — reads gateway and DNS from camera shell
